### Understanding Root Canal Infection

A root canal infection usually starts when bacteria enter the inner part of your tooth, known as the pulp. This can happen due to deep decay, repeated dental procedures, cracked teeth, or injury. Once bacteria reach the pulp, they cause inflammation and infection, leading to sensitivity, pain when chewing, and even swelling around the gums and face.

If left untreated, the infection can spread, eventually causing the tooth to die, or worse, leading to an abscess that affects surrounding bone and tissue. That’s why professional dental care is essential — and Thailand offers world-class dental services that focus on both comfort and results.

### What Happens During a Root Canal Treatment in Thailand

Root canal treatment in Thailand generally involves several steps that are carefully performed to ensure the tooth is thoroughly cleaned and restored. Here’s what patients can expect:

1. **Consultation and Diagnosis**

Your dentist will first examine your tooth using X-rays to determine the extent of infection. They’ll explain the treatment plan, cost, and recovery process in detail. Communication is usually easy, as most Thai dentists are fluent in English.

2. **Local Anesthesia and Preparation**

The area around the affected tooth will be numbed to keep you comfortable. Thai dental clinics are known for their gentle approach, and many patients report surprisingly little discomfort during the procedure.

3. **Removing the Infected Pulp**

The dentist will carefully open the tooth crown and remove the infected tissue from inside the canal. This step eliminates bacteria and prevents further infection.

4. **Cleaning and Shaping the Canal**

The inner canal is cleaned using advanced tools and disinfectants. It’s then shaped for sealing to ensure no germs remain inside.

5. **Filling and Sealing**

### Tips for Smooth Recovery After Root Canal Treatment

1. **Follow Dentist Instructions:** Always complete prescribed antibiotics and avoid chewing on the treated side until it’s fully restored.

2. **Maintain Oral Hygiene:** Brush gently twice daily, use mouthwash, and floss regularly.

3. **Avoid Hard Foods:** Stay away from nuts, ice, or hard candies that could stress the treated tooth.

4. **Schedule Regular Check-ups:** Follow-up appointments help monitor healing and ensure long-term tooth health.

5. **Stay Hydrated and Rest:** Good hydration and rest help reduce inflammation and promote faster recovery.

### Root Canal Treatment and Long-Term Dental Health

Once the infection is cleared, the treated tooth can last for many years with proper care. Many patients in Thailand find that root canal therapy restores their confidence to smile, eat, and speak again without discomfort. Moreover, by preserving the natural tooth, it prevents potential tooth shifting and bone loss — something that extraction would not achieve.
